    3. This is Will #4 Abstract, as done by my late aunt, Laura E. Rogers (1899-1973). I should mention that the wills so far are not my direct line. Those wills I will have to abstract myself, when I have time. The Restore Shinn LAMB mentioned in this will abstract is the son of Jacob LAMB and Elizabeth SHINN. Jacob was married second to Beulah RIDGWAY, whose will was #1. I have Jacob's will in its entirety and will have to abstract that one as well. Jacob was a son of Joseph LAMB Sr. and Rebecca BUDD. The LAMB family was one of the early families of Burlington County, New Jersey and the earliest deed I have is of the immigrant , also named Jacob LAMB, married to Ann -?-), in the year 1699 when Jacob LAMB bought land of Robert POWELL in Northampton Twp. The LAMBs were English Quakers. Jacob and Ann had children: Mary, Ann, Jacob, Margret, John and Joseph SR. Will of Restore S. LAMB. (His first wife was Mary RIDGWAY and the children in this will were hers. His second wife was Rhoda OSBORN.) Burlington County Wills #17300C. Written: 1 April 1864, Restore of Mt. Holly, Burlington Co.,NJ "Wife - Rhoda O. LAMB - $400 a year *4 Grandsons - Howard WHITE, Joseph J. WHITE, George F. WHITE, Barclay M. WHITE - children of my beloved daughter, Rebecca M. WHITE who is deceased-- cedar swamp from John CHAMBERS. *Sons - Benjamin R. LAMB and Restore B. LAMB. - who are also Executors Witnesses- Abraham MERRITT, James LIPPINCOTT Proved: 28 August 1867, Chas. E. FOLWELL - Surrogate Inventory: 23 August 1867- $12,887.86 My late aunt has a note that Rhoda Osborn LAMB died 5th mo., 19 da., 1880. She did not note what Quaker MM this was from, but I would assume that it would be whatever MM was in connection with Mt. Holly. I believe I have a note that Rhoda and her husband were Hicksite ministers. Donna Ristenbatt DRistenbatt@aol.com

    3. This will abstract is that of Joseph LAMB Jr., son of Joseph LAMB Sr. and his wife, Rebecca BUDD. The Joseph LAMB of the will below was first married to Mary EARL in 1777. Mary died in 1798, leaving only one daughter, Mercy, behind. Joseph remarried to Elizabeth -?- and they had four known sons. You will find other names besides LAMB in this will. Donna Ristenbatt DRistenbatt@aol.com Will abstract as done by Laura E. Rogers for Joseph LAMB of New Hanover Twp., Burlington County. Will written: April 10, 1820. Will proved: June 12, 1820 Burlington County Wills #13126C. "1st- debts paid, etc. 2nd - Executors to sell and convey all my estate both real and personal as soon as they can- land sales not to be deferred longer than 3 years after my decease. 3rd - To my daughter, Mercy SHINN- $1,000.00 to be paid after sale of my lands[Donna note: Anyone know her husband's first name and parentage?] 4th - Residue and remainder of my estate to my beloved wife, Elizabeth LAMB - and to my four sons - Joseph LAMB[Donna note: This one married Atlantic -?-]; Samuel LAMB; Charles LAMB; and Caleb LAMB, to be equally divided amongst them share and share alike - to be paid to them as they shall arrive at the age of 21 years provided the sale of my lands has been effected, and in case of the death of either of my sons before they arrive at the age of 21 or without lawful issue then his or their share to be equally divided amongst the survivors. Lastly - I appoint my loving wife Elizabeth LAMB and my trusty friend William POPE executors of my last will and testament and guardian to my children during their minority. Set hand and seal - 10th April 1820. Joseph LAMB Witnesses: Isaac FOOG(?) Warren EARL- John WARREN Before the Surrogate 12th day of June 1820 Surr. BROWN. Signed by Elizabeth LAMB. Inv. of Personal Estate - June 10, 1820. $964.87 and 1/2 Appraised by Abraham MERRITT and Isaac FOOG.

    3. This is another will abstract done by my late aunt, Laura E. Rogers (1899- 1973). The Atlantic LAMB (female) appeared on the 1860 census of the other day. The Joseph in this will is the son of Joseph LAMB Jr. married first to Mary EARL, dau of William EARL. They had one daugther, Mercy. Mary EARL died in 1798. Joseph LAMB Jr. married second Elizabeth -?- Joseph LAMB Jr. was the son of Joseph LAMB Sr. married to Rebecca BUDD. The Beulah Ridgway LAMB in the previous will abstract was the second wife of Jacob LAMB. (First wife was Elizabeth SHINN.) Jacob LAMB and Joseph LAMB Jr. were brothers. They had a brother, Nehemiah LAMB, who is my ancestor, married first to Lettice FOSTER, dau of Amariah FOSTER. Lettice married second -?- RINEER. Anyone know his first name? Donna Ristenbatt DRistenbatt@aol.com Joseph married second, Elizabeth-?- and they had four sons.First wife was Mary Earl, by whom he had daughter, Mercy. "Lamb, Joseph of New Hanover Twp., Burlington County, Will 1852, Provd. 1852.  1st- Debts paid 2nd- Executors to sell all my estate real and personal within one year after my decease - executors to pay my mother Elizabeth LAMB annually a sum of $100. 3rd - To my son, Caleb LAMB - $500 when he attains 21 years. 4th - To my daughter - Rebecca LAMB - $300 when 18 years of age.  All the rest and remainder of my estate to my beloved wife - Atlantick LAMB, and to my children - Mary L. or S. LAMB - Lydia W. LAMB- Elizabeth LAMB- Sarah W. LAMB - Caleb S. LAMB - and Rebecca B. LAMB - share and share alike. It is my will and I do hereby order the above bequest paid to my beloved wife in lieu of her right of dower and I do hereby authorize my executors to pay all money or monies herein before devised and bequeathed to my minor children, Caleb S. LAMB and Rebecca B. LAMB to their regular appointed guardian, and in the event of either of their deaths during their minority then the money to be equally divided between the surviving children and their mother, share and share alike. I appoint my brother, Charles N. LAMB and Henry SMITH Executors. Set hand and seal, May 31, 1852.  Witnesses: Wm. FOX, Jos. PETTIT, Jos. L. LAMB Proved: June 19, 1852, Benj. BUCKMAN, Surr.  Inventory: June 18th, 1852, $1,629.49. Appraiser - Jos. L. LAMB and Alex NEWBOLD.

"I, Beulah LAMB of the Township of Springfield, Burlington County, relict of Jacob LAMB late of Burlington County dec'd., being advanced in age etc.- do make this my last will and testament-  To my step-son Jacob LAMB- my 8 day clock for his life - then he to his son Jacob and his heirs forever. To my grand-daughter Sarah T. NEWBOLD - daughter of Abraham MERRITT dec'd. $100 and case of drawers. To my grand-daughter Elizabeth BODINE- daughter of Clayton LAMB - sheets, pillow cases, tablecloth, etc. To my two grand-daughters - Elizabeth LAMB and Beulah LAMB - daughters of Jacob LAMB, $50. To my friend Elizabeth COX $150. - for her services to me. To Adelaide LAMB - grand-daughter of Clayton LAMB - a bureau. To Mary ROGERS- daughter of Jacob LAMB- one bed and blue curtains. All my books, except my family Bible - I give to Clayton LAMB, Jacob LAMB and the children of Rebecca MERRITT(dec'd.) All the rest and including my family Bible - I give to Restore S. LAMB and his heirs. I appoint as my Executor- my step-son, Restore S. LAMB. 1844- 19th of April Beulah LAMB- sign and seal Witnesses: John CHAMBERS Barclay WHITE Surrogate: BUCKMAN Proved: 19th of August 1848 Inventory: $1,068.00 by Barclay WHITE appraiser - 11 mo. 15-1848 Recorded- Office of Secr'y. of State- Trenton, NJ. NO. 15416C Donna Ristenbatt DRistenbatt@aol.com

    2. Is anyone on this list researching the GIBBS family in New Jersey? I am looking for the parents of Mahlon GIBBS. He was born 31 Aug.1793 in Burlington Co., NJ and died 1 Jan 1872 in Preble Co.OH. I think that he is the son of Richard GIBBS, born abt. 1778, Mansfield Twp. Burlington Co.NJ and died 24 Nov 1819 in the same place and his wife Mary ( have no last name). Mahlon married prior to 1825 to Julia Ann BRITTAIN in New Jersey. Richard's father was also Richard GIBBS, born 1740, Mansfield Twp.Burlington Co.NJ, died 13 Jan 1804, Burlington Co. NJ and his wife Mary Burroughs. This Richard's father was John GIBBS, born 6 Apr 1706, died 5 Jun 1785 and his wife Hannah Lucas. The ancestors of both Malon GIBBS and his wife Julia Ann BRITTAIN were Quakers but do not know if Mahlon was a practicing Quaker either in NJ or after moving to Ohio in 1830. I have no proof that Mahlon is the son of Richard and Mary - he was listed as a son in someone's family history. I know he was related to, or accociated with, the Newbold, Reading and Beck families because of the names given his children. Can anyone give me some help in establlishing the parents of Mahlon GIBBS, my gr gr gr grandfather. Betty McCollum Padilla
